How Do You Unclog A Shower Drain

2026-02-11

A clogged shower drain is most commonly caused by hair buildup, soap residue, mineral deposits, or accumulated debris inside the pipe. While unclogging is typically a maintenance task, the long-term frequency of blockage often reflects drain design quality, surface finishing, and installation precision.

1. Assess The Severity Of The Clog

Common symptoms include:

  • Slow draining water

  • Standing water in the shower pan

  • Gurgling sounds from the drain

  • Unpleasant odor

If water is fully backed up, immediate manual clearing is required before attempting pressure methods.


2. Remove The Drain Cover

First:

  • Unscrew or carefully lift the drain grate

  • Protect tile surfaces from scratches

  • Inspect for visible debris

Precision-machined drain covers are easier to remove and reinstall without damaging threads or finish.


3. Remove Hair And Surface Debris

Hair is the most frequent cause of blockage.

Use:

  • A flexible plastic drain snake

  • A manual hair removal tool

  • Protective gloves

Insert the tool, rotate gently, and pull debris out slowly. Repeat until resistance decreases.

Mechanical removal is safer and more effective than chemicals for surface clogs.


4. Use A Plunger

If drainage is still slow:

  • Add enough water to cover the plunger base

  • Seal overflow openings if present

  • Apply firm plunging pressure

  • Test water flow

Pressure changes can dislodge partial obstructions deeper in the line.


5. Use A Plumbing Auger For Deep Blockages

For stubborn clogs:

  • Insert a hand auger into the drain

  • Rotate while feeding cable forward

  • Withdraw carefully to remove blockage

This method is effective for deeper pipe obstructions.


6. Avoid Harsh Chemical Cleaners

Chemical cleaners may:

  • Damage PVC or metal piping

  • Corrode brass drain components

  • Degrade rubber seals

  • Shorten system lifespan

Mechanical cleaning is recommended for long-term plumbing protection.
